500 Absentee ballots in Palm Beach County not counted
http://www.wptv.com/dpp/news/political/election-supervisor%3A-500-absentee-ballots-in-palm-beach-county-not-counted

Approximately 500 absentee ballot for the General Election were not counted according to Palm Beach County Supervisor of Elections Susan Bucher. PBC election officials said in a press release that they made this discovery while recounting the close District 6 School Board race between Marcia Andrews and Dean Grossman.

"Unfortunately, what appears to have been human error has resulted in a number of absentee ballots not having been counted," said Bucher in the press release.

The number of uncounted ballots could possibly affect not only the School Board recount, but also the still unofficial results of several other close local races, according to Bucher.

5. ALL valid vote-by-mail ballots are counted in every election in California
They may not be included in late night results, or even Wednesday morning tallies, but they are counted before the county registrars sign off on them and send the certified results to the Secretary of State to sign off on.

The absentee ballots deposited at polling locations are the last to be counted.
